HMS 'Bellona' or 'Boadicea' at Scapa Flow, 1916-17
A monochrome study of a four-stacker Royal Naval scout cruiser - either the 'Bellona' or the 'Boadicea' - lying at anchor or moorings against high land apparently at Scapa Flow, and shown in the period 1916-17 before both were converted to minelayers.
